#FCDDCF Color
#FCDDCF is rgb(252, 221, 207) in RGB, hsl(19, 88%, 90%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 12%, 18%, 1%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Unbleached Silk (#FFDDCA),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 2.95.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#FCDDCF Channel Values
How #FCDDCF bre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 252 · G 221 · B 207 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 19° · S 88% · L 90%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 19° · S 18% · V 99%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 12% · Y 18% · K 1%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.28:1 vs white · 16.38: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#FCDDCF background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#FCDDCF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#FCDDCF?
#FCDDCF is a lightest orange — rgb(252, 221, 207) in RGB and hsl(19, 88%, 90%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Unbleached Silk (#FFDDCA),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 2.95.
What is the RGB value of #FCDDCF?
#FCDDCF is rgb(252, 221, 207) — red 252, green 221, and blue 207 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#FCDDCF?
#FCDDCF conver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 12%, 18%, 1%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#FCDDCF be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#FCDDCF scores 1.28:1 against white and 16.38: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#FCDDCF as a CSS color keyword?
No. #FCDDCF is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mistyrose (#FFE4E1) at a CIE76 distance of 6.45,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
